  • UHD Graphics 620 has 25% more power consumption, than Radeon R7 Carrizo.
  • Both cards are used in Laptops.
  • Radeon R7 Carrizo is build with GCN 1.2/2.0 architecture, and UHD Graphics 620 - with Gen. 9.5.
  • Radeon R7 Carrizo is manufactured by 28 nm process technology, and UHD Graphics 620 - by 14 nm process technology.
